The Texas Instruments MSP430F435IPN is a low-power, 16-bit microcontroller (MCU) based on the RISC architecture. It is part of the MSP430 family of microcontrollers, which are known for their low-power consumption, high performance, and ease of use. The MSP430F435IPN is specifically designed for a wide range of applications, including industrial control, portable devices, and energy measurement systems.
